At what age do platies start to breed (both male and female)?

I had 1 remaining pregnant female platy plus 2 female juveniles. There have been no males in the tank since before juveniles were born, so the juvies were virgin females. My adult female gave birth to approx 8 fry and promptly died (this was her 3rd birth).

The new fry are now 2 weeks and 3 days old and they all look female, in which case as there are no males present they will all be virgins and I will keep them. However should there be a rogue male in there I want to know at which point should i get worried about pregnancy occuring.

I don't think you need worry until the gonopodium is actually showing. I take my platy and guppy males out at this stage, and haven't had an unwanted pregnancy yet, touch wood.
